Solution for 9c^2-39c=30 equation:



9c^2-39c=30
We move all terms to the left:
9c^2-39c-(30)=0
a = 9; b = -39; c = -30;
Δ = b2-4ac
Δ = -392-4·9·(-30)
Δ = 2601
The delta value is higher than zero, so the equation has two solutions
We use following formulas to calculate our solutions:
$c_{1}=\frac{-b-\sqrt{\Delta}}{2a}$
$c_{2}=\frac{-b+\sqrt{\Delta}}{2a}$

$\sqrt{\Delta}=\sqrt{2601}=51$
$c_{1}=\frac{-b-\sqrt{\Delta}}{2a}=\frac{-(-39)-51}{2*9}=\frac{-12}{18} =-2/3 $
$c_{2}=\frac{-b+\sqrt{\Delta}}{2a}=\frac{-(-39)+51}{2*9}=\frac{90}{18} =5 $
